Deportivo La Coruña has sold Walter Pandiani to Birmingham for 4.5 million euros in what had become one of the toughest negotiations this summer. The Uruguayan striker will finally stay in the team where he was loaned for another three seasons.
After seven months of negotiations, Depor and the Blues reached an agreement over Pandiani’s transfer. The Spanish team will receive around 4.5 million euros, fee that could be increased according to some clauses in which Birmingham will pay more depending on the results of the team, such as qualifying for Europe.
The 29-year-old striker played for the Blues last season on loan from Deportivo La Coruña, and a conflict was created when new manager Joaquín Caparrós didn’t want him back in the team, and the player himself didn’t want to return.
This way, the Spanish side are now in financial conditions of buying a new player, that would be a powerful striker with good aerial abilities.
